The show was created by Eric Morley , the founder of Miss World , and began in 1949 by broadcasting from regional ballroom studios, with professional dancers Syd Perkins and Edna Duffield on hand to offer teaching.

In 1953 the format changed to become a competition, with later series seeing regions of the United Kingdom going head to head for the coveted trophy.

The many presenters over the years included Peter West , Terry Wogan , Brian Johnston , Angela Rippon , Michael Aspel , Noel Edmonds , David Jacobs , Judith Chalmers , Pete Murray , and Rosemarie Ford . Commentators included Ray Moore , Bruce Hammal , Charles Nove .

In 2004 , a re-launched celebrity version entitled '' Strictly Come Dancing '', hosted by Bruce Forsyth , debuted on BBC One , and became a popular hit on Saturday evenings. The format of the newer show has been successfully exported under the name ''Dancing with the Stars'' in both Australia and The U.S.




''Come Dancing'' is also the title of a song by The Kinks .
